    I came across this vise which is a 2 in 1 design.

    It appears to be the basic design of the old Xuron vise, but has two vise heads: a regular set of jaws; and a tube fly head.

    Personally, I don't tie tube flies, but understand a number of folks here do.

    As I said, it is quite similar to the Xuron vise, but has two interchangable heads. Normal jaws and a tube fly head.
    the Xuron design allows the vise to be moved to many positions as the stem is on a ball and I think this one is also.

    again, the unique feature are the interchangable heads.
